Course Overview

As an Environmental Technician specialising in Water Resource Management at Confederation College, you will gain the essential skills to address critical environmental challenges in water systems. This undergraduate diploma is designed for proactive individuals eager to apply scientific principles to protect and restore vital water resources, a field increasingly important for ecological health and community well-being. You will explore key areas such as hydrogeology, water quality, and treatment processes, preparing you for a meaningful career in environmental protection and sustainable resource management.

This full-time, on-campus program is structured over two years, providing you with a hands-on learning experience. You will engage with practical applications through field schools, laboratory analysis, and the study of geographical information systems (GIS). The curriculum covers natural resource measurements, soils and geomorphology, and environmental legislation, ensuring you develop a comprehensive understanding. You will graduate with the ability to collect environmental samples, analyse data, and contribute to effective water resource management strategies, ready for roles in government agencies, environmental consulting firms, and industry.

Program Overview

This program provides foundational knowledge and practical skills for managing water resources. Students will explore environmental chemistry, natural resource measurement, and soil science, alongside essential mathematical and writing skills. The curriculum also includes opportunities for field experience and elective courses in areas such as ecology, plant biology, and geographical information systems, preparing graduates for roles in environmental protection and resource management.
